What We Cover in This Episode
✨ The things we’d tell new clients if we weren’t worried about hurting feelings
Why your skin isn’t “broken,” why consistency matters more than trends, and why one treatment can’t undo years of inflammation.
✨ The most underrated treatments (and why hype isn’t the same as results)
Why microneedling and corrective, intentional facials still outperform many viral treatments — and how pairing them with the right home care actually changes outcomes.
✨ The biggest misconception about “hormonal skin”
Yes, hormones matter — but lifestyle, stress, sleep, nutrition, and inflammation are usually the missing pieces no one wants to look at.
✨ If you could only commit to ONE treatment
Why consistency with a customizable facial approach can outperform sporadic, high-intensity treatments.
✨ Why “basic” skincare often works better than complicated routines
And why adding more products is rarely the answer.
✨ The biggest disconnect between client expectations and skin biology
Skin heals in months, not days. Progress is cumulative, not instant — and maintenance isn’t optional.
